    Country Programme Manager

    Key accountabilities but not limited to:

    • Lead programme design, work‑planning, and implementation in alignment with Sightsavers thematic strategies.
    • Lead in setting direction, assuring quality, managing risk and making decisions while supporting Project Managers and Officers handle day to day delivery.
    • Provide technical leadership to ensure programmes are evidence‑based, disability inclusive, gender responsive and scalable.
    • Oversee through structured reviews, performance management and escalation the end‑to‑end management of multiple projects, ensuring delivery on time, within scope, and on budget.
    • Ensure high-quality delivery, compliance with donor and internal standards, and alignment with global programme quality frameworks.
    • Strengthen programme quality through routine reviews, risk management, adaptive programming, and quality assurance mechanisms.
    • Drive learning, innovation, and documentation of best practices across the programme portfolio.
    • Promote a culture of evidence-driven learning and continuous improvement across all interventions.
    • Provide direction and support to assist country teams and help them to identify opportunities and learnings to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of programme delivery in Kenya

    Essential knowledge and skills

    • Master’s degree in international development, Public Health, Social Sciences, Development Studies, or a related field.
    • Demonstrate progressive experience in programme management within NGOs/INGOs or development agencies.
    • Proven track record managing large, complex, multi-country or multi-donor programmes.
    • Strong technical expertise relevant to the organization’s thematic areas (for example health, education, livelihoods, disability inclusion).
    • Strong leadership and people-management capabilities
    • Excellent strategic thinking, problem-solving, and decision‑making abilities.
    • High proficiency in programme cycle management and MEL.
    • Current and ongoing right to work in Kenya
